1. (a) Why is the spectrometer with the magnetic field of 14.1 T called "600 MHz" NMR spectrometer? (b) What is Av (in Hz) corresponding to 1 ppm in 'H spectrum collected on a "600 MHz" NMR spectrometer? What's the difference between the procession frequences of two protons that show up at 1.5 ppm and 2.6 ppm, respectively? (c) What is the resonance frequency of 43 Ca be on a "600 MHz" NMR spectrometer? What will Av (in Hz) corresponding to 1 ppm be in this case?
